How much does it cost to rent a home in Belmont?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Belmont 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,727 | $1,195 | $2,995 |
| Belmont 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,187 | $1,300 | $3,330 |
| Belmont 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,732 | $2,110 | $3,300 |
| Belmont 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,983 | $2,595 | $3,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Belmont
What type of rentals are currently available in Belmont?
There are currently 58 Apartments for Rent in Belmont, NC with pricing that ranges from $1,025 to $15,686. There are also 85 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Belmont ranging from $745 to $3,600.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Belmont?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Belmont ranges from $745 to $3,600 with an average monthly rent of $2,074.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Belmont?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Belmont range from $1,715 to $2,745,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,300 to $3,330.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,110 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,379.
